SIC WOWS THE WILKINS SCHOLARS
FITSNews – May 7, 2008 – We’re gonna go out on a limb and guess that U.S. Ambassador to Canada David H. Wilkins blew a gasket when he learned that our own Sic Willie (a frequent Wilkins’ critic ) spoke this afternoon to Furman University’s “David Wilkins Fellows,” a group of politically-minded college students who are spending some time in Columbia learning the legislative ropes.
Sic arrived at the event wearing his throwback Cal Ripken, Jr. jersey and a Hooters’ hat (editor’s note: classy ) and proceeded to illustrate how lobbyists destroy meaningful reforms from the inside out (using a turkey sandwich prop) as well as from the outside in (using a chicken nugget prop). Yeah … better not ask.
He also drew some pretty funny pictures of Gov. Mark Sanford, Rep. Harry Cato and Rep. Bob Walker on the whiteboard, and explained Leadership PACs to the students in a manner that Bobby Harrell would have no doubt found highly offensive.
Anyway, props to the “Wilkins Fellows” for having FITS over, and come to think of it, props to Wilkins himself. We’ve been pretty hard on the guy in the past, but in retrospect (unlike Harrell) he at least tried to act like a Republican every once in awhile …
